Jacksonville Vs Arkansas And National Crime Rates

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in Jacksonville is 4,910.6 per 100,000 people. That's 131.71% higher than the national rate of 2,119.2 per 100,000 people and 95.72% higher than the Arkansas total crime rate of 2,508.9 per 100,000 people.

Violent Crime Rates In Jacksonville

275Violent Crimes
949.7Violent Crimes / 100k People
164.53%Above The National Average
Jacksonville
US
  • There were 275 violent crimes in Jacksonville in the last reporting year.
  • The violent crime rate in Jacksonville is 949.7 per 100,000 people.
  • You have a 1 in 105.3 chance of being the victim of a violent crime in Jacksonville each year. That compares to a 1 in 172.6 chance statewide.
  • That's 164.53% higher than the national rate of 359.0 per 100,000 people.
  • And 63.91% higher than the Arkansas violent crime rate of 579.4 per 100,000 people.
